vhost-user-scsi: use glib logging
- PLOG is unused - code is compiled out unless debug is enabled - logging is too verbose - you can pipe to ts to have timestamp if needed, or use structured logging with more recent glib Signed-off-by: Marc-André Lureau <marcandre.lureau@redhat.com> Reviewed-by: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<f4bug@amsat.org>
